Subject: New Rabbit

I bought a dwarf lop yesterday from a petshop, she had just been taken in that morning so she hadn't got used to the environment of the petshop.
I got her home and she is very shy as expected.
She doesn't even like been stroked. I read that you aren't supposed to pick rabbits up. So what is the best way for her to get used to me? She is very nervous I sit on the floor with her but she doesn't even dare come and sniff me.
She is living in a hutch in my bedroom at thje moment but I leave the doors open so she can hop around and get used to the environment.
Any advice is welcome - this is my first rabbit since I was about three years old! Thanks
